Nature Conservation Egypt (NCE) is an Egyptian NGO working towards conserving Egypt’s natural heritage and the promotion of its sustainable use, for the benefit of present and future generations.
Established in 2005 by a number of Egypt’s leading experts in the field of nature and biodiversity conservation, NCE is specialised in scientific research, advocacy, education and outreach to support species, their habitats, and local communities. NCE works in partnership with local experts and governmental bodies, as well as international organisations and partnerships to ensure efficient collaboration for conservation within and across borders.
NCE is the Birdlife International partner in Egypt, and is a member of the International Union for the Conservation of Nature (IUCN).

For many years, NCE served as an affiliate of Birdlife International, and in 2019, the Birdlife Global Council formally accepted NCE as the official Birdlife Partner for Egypt.
NCE is also a partner of the African Biodiversity Network, which works to strengthen the conservation of biocultural diversity and promote food sovereignty across Africa through capacity building, networking, and advocacy
